Safety Information
WARNING: Not recommended for children under 10 months of age. Always ensure adult supervision when the child is using the trike. Failure to follow these instructions may result in serious injury.
- Always ensure all parts are correctly assembled and securely fastened before each use.
- Do not use the trike near stairs, on steep slopes, or in areas with heavy traffic.
- Ensure the child's feet are always on the footrests or pedals to prevent injury.
- Regularly check for loose parts, worn components, or damage. Discontinue use if any damage is found.
- The safety harness must always be used when the child is in the trike, especially in the early stages.
- This product is certified to EN 1888-1 for pushchairs and buggies, indicating compliance with European safety standards for child care articles.

Operating Instructions
Stage 1: Parental Control Mode (10+ Months)
In this stage, the trike functions as a pushchair, with the parent fully controlling direction and movement. The child is secured by the safety harness and rests their feet on the footrests.
- Intuitive Steering Bar: The parent handle allows for easy and precise steering of the front wheel.
- Safety Harness: Always secure the child with the multi-point safety harness.
- Retractable Footrests: Ensure footrests are extended for the child's comfort and safety.
- Sunshade: Adjust the 360° sunshade to protect the child from sun exposure.
- Freewheel System: Engage the freewheel system on the front wheel to prevent pedals from rotating with the wheel, protecting the child's feet.
- Brake: Use the parking brake located on the rear wheels to secure the trike when stationary.

Stage 2: Assisted Pedaling Mode (15+ Months)
As your child grows and develops motor skills, they can begin to practice pedaling while the parent still maintains control over steering and speed.
- Engage Pedals: Disengage the freewheel system to allow the child to pedal.
- Retract Footrests: Fold away the footrests to encourage pedaling.
- Parental Steering: Continue to use the parent handle for steering and guidance.
- Safety Harness: Continue to use the safety harness for security.
Stage 3: Independent Trike Mode (30+ Months)
Once your child is confident in pedaling and steering, the trike can be converted into a fully independent tricycle.
- Remove Parent Handle: Detach the parent steering bar.
- Remove Sunshade: Detach the sunshade.
- Remove Safety Bar/Harness: Remove any remaining safety bars or harnesses if your child is capable of independent riding.
- Child Steering: The child now steers using the handlebars.

Maintenance
Regular maintenance ensures the longevity and safe operation of your trike.
- Cleaning: The seat cover is removable and washable. Follow care instructions on the label. For other parts, wipe clean with a damp cloth and mild soap. Do not use abrasive cleaners.
- Inspection: Periodically check all screws, bolts, and fasteners to ensure they are tight. Inspect wheels, pedals, and steering for any signs of wear or damage.
- Storage: Store the trike in a clean, dry place away from direct sunlight and extreme temperatures to prevent material degradation.
Troubleshooting
If you encounter any issues with your Smoby Baby Driver Comfort Trike, please refer to the following common solutions:
- Loose Parts: If any parts feel loose, check the corresponding fasteners and tighten them securely. Do not overtighten.
- Steering Issues: Ensure the parent handle is correctly inserted and locked into place. For independent mode, check that the handlebars are securely attached.
- Pedals Not Turning: Verify that the freewheel system is disengaged if the child is attempting to pedal. Check for any obstructions around the pedals or wheels.
- Squeaking Noises: Apply a small amount of silicone-based lubricant to moving parts like wheel axles or pedal mechanisms if squeaking occurs. Avoid oil-based lubricants that can attract dirt.
